Manufacturer Provided Description

Highly skilled artisans at the Alexander Marine boatyard in Koahsiung, Taiwan handcraft each Ocean Alexander 520 Pilothouse. The pride in their craft is obvious. Wood joints are glued and secured by screws, and parquet teak decks have a clean look (no wood plugs). The counter tops lay flat, and all fiberglass surfaces have a polished gelcoat finish. The 520 Pilothouse is loaded with standard features, including modified semidisplacement hulls and planing hulls that deliver superior performance, comfort, and great fuel economy. This hand-laid fiberglass hull is constructed by our expert artisans using only the finest materials available. The unique balsa core technology - used on the hull sides, topside, and superstructure - adds strength, reduces vibration and noise, and is very watertight. Also, anti-fouling black paint is applied to the hull bottom. Other standard features include trim tabs, engine hour meters, hinged fiberglass radar mast, cedar-lined closets, deck lights, swim ladders, platforms, and lighted stairways.
